Analysis
In 2024, other citrus fruit, n.e.c. — gross production value in Qatar stood at 964 1000 SLC.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 23.5% on the previous year and up 18.6% over ten years.
Over the whole period, other citrus fruit, n.e.c. — gross production value in Qatar peaked at 3,456 1000 SLC in 2021 and was at its lowest, 412 1000 SLC, in 2020.
That places Qatar 42nd out of 46 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 34 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 1,765 1000 SLC | 1,061 1000 SLC | 2,574 1000 SLC | 9 |
| 2000s | 2,744 1000 SLC | 1,439 1000 SLC | 3,235 1000 SLC | 10 |
| 2010s | 1,275 1000 SLC | 681 1000 SLC | 2,245 1000 SLC | 10 |
| 2020s | 1,861 1000 SLC | 412 1000 SLC | 3,456 1000 SLC | 5 |

About this data
The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
